Semi-Convergence in Advanced Topological Frameworks

Abstract

This study establishes the interplay between standard convergence and semi-convergence in topological spaces. Convergence and semi-convergence differences are illustrated with a counterexample. Additionally, an examination of semi-convergence's behavior in irresolute mappings reveals how it affects continuity and function characteristics. Semi-limit points and semi-cluster points are defined in new ways and their features in different topological settings are described by essential theorems. The final section looks at how semi-convergence behaves in product spaces, showing how it interacts with product topologies and establishing important findings that enhance the field's understanding of its study.
